Its either that, or built in set of shelves in the starboard storage pod where the trash can is, I was thinking that area could be made more useful, with the same set up in mind, except I don’t think it would hold as many trays. The advantage of that area is the padded top of the storage pod and the cc seat. I usually sit there when I’m tying up leaders or rigging something up. I currently keep a four tray tackle bag in that area and that works out good, I have another identical bag that’s in the head compartment with extras and different lures. I had thought that if I could come up with a tray type of storage, when my fiends came fishing with me they could just bring a couple of trays and put them there and it would eliminate everyone bringing their own tackle bags / boxes.
